Bloc de construction de KPI d'opération
Le bloc de construction de KPI d'opération fournit la majeure partie de la logique métier pour la solution DPM. Cela inclut, sans s'y limiter, la lecture et l'écriture des données de perte, la collecte des données automatisées, les services de requête utilisés pour l'Analyse des performances, la création et la logique de bloc de production, etc. En raison des exigences de calcul de la solution DPM, il est nécessaire de recourir à la programmation SQL Server pour ce bloc de construction, en tirant parti des fonctions et des procédures stockées, le cas échéant.
Le bloc de construction de KPI d'opération fournit également l'orchestration des données entre les blocs de construction de l'interface utilisateur (Tableau de bord de production, Analyse des performances, Suivi des actions et administration) et les
blocs de construction spécifiques au domaine. Lorsque des données de plusieurs blocs de construction spécifiques à un type sont nécessaires, les appels passent généralement par le bloc de construction de KPI d'opération pour accéder aux différents blocs de construction de niveau inférieur spécifiques au type.
Le bloc de construction de KPI d'opération est constitué d'un bloc de construction abstrait (PTC.OperationKPI) et d'un bloc de construction d'implémentation (PTC.OperationKPIImpl). Vous pouvez afficher le contenu de ces blocs de construction en visualisant les projets PTC.OperationKPI et PTC.OperationKPIImpl dans ThingWorx Composer.
Dépendances
Le projet PTC.OperationKPI présente les dépendances suivantes :
• PTC.Base
• PTC.ReasonCode
• PTC.ModelManagement
• PTC.Shift
• PTC.JobOrder
• PTC.StateMachine
• PTC.WorkMaster
• PTC.MfgModel
• PTC.Action
Le projet PTC.OperationKPIImpl possède les dépendances suivantes :
• PTC.OperationKPI
• PTC.DBConnection
• PTC.DefaultConfiguration